CI note: Marblequill markdown pipeline failing at the sanitize stage on runner pool B. Root cause: stale parser grammar cached from a pre-hardening build, allowing raw HTML passthrough that the strict gate now rejects. Not a regression in sanitization itself — the gate works. Fix: purge the grammar cache, pin the grammar artifact by digest, re-run. Verified clean on pools A and C. No tainted artifacts were published; the quarantine step held them. The known-good build reference is recorded below.

build token for fahap-yagag: htk3_d09

// Notes for the weekly eng sync re: Gallerywhisper, our museum audio-guide app.
// This constant sets the prefetch radius for exhibit audio clips. At the
// Hollen Pavilion pilot we learned visitors walk faster than our original
// estimate, so clips were buffering mid-stride. Bumping this to three rooms
// ahead fixed it, at a modest bandwidth cost. Don't lower it without testing
// on the slow gallery wifi first — seriously, it's painful. The trace token
// from the pilot build that validated this number is appended just below.

trace token, kahap-bagaf: htk4_8458

Quick vendor update for the sync: Stagewright (the folks doing the seat-map renderer for the Pellbrook Theatre project) shipped build 0.9 on Tuesday. Zoom and pan are smooth now, but accessible-seat badges still render behind the balcony overlay. They've promised a fix before our Friday demo. Contract renewal paperwork is with procurement, nothing for us to do there yet. If you spot rendering glitches in staging, flag them straight to their integration lead.

escalation mailbox, badup-fawef: holwyn@paliqworks.corp

### 0.9.4 — FD Leak Hunt

Tracked down the descriptor leak that was killing Marlowgate workers after ~6h uptime. Root cause: retry path in the archive fetcher opened sockets without closing on timeout. Fixed with context-managed connections; added an fd-count assertion to the soak test so this can't silently regress. New folks: run `make soak` before merging anything touching the fetcher. Questions on the fix go to the engineer who led the hunt.

named custodian: Brivan Eliath Quenox Frador